Right now I'm to blame: I need to review the infrastructure and its pattern of use. Once that's done, the next questions are what level of review we want for the instances of the pattern, and how to merge the thing. One way is to split along subsystems boundaries, and ask subsystem maintainers to merge their part. Infrastructure has to go first, of course. That would be my job as error subsystem maintainer. Getting everything merged via pretty much every subsystem we have will likely be a drawn out affair. Another way is to go ahead and merge everything, damn the torpedoes.
